Fixing Myers Well Pump Issues
Dealing with a faulty Myers well pump can be a real headache. Before you replace the whole unit, take a deep breath and try some simple troubleshooting steps. First, check if your {well's{power supply is working correctly by inspecting your electrical circuit breaker. Make sure the control panel for your well pump is in the on position. Next, look at the {pressure tank{ to see if it's properly charged. If you detect any unusual noises coming from the pump, like grinding or rattling, that could indicate a {serious{ problem.
- Inspect the {well's{ pressure switch for any signs of malfunction.
- Clear out any dirt or sediment that may be clogging the impeller.
- {Check{ your well pump's discharge line for leaks or cracks.
If you've tried these steps and your well pump is still operating improperly, it's best to call a qualified well drilling specialist. They can diagnose the {problem{ and repair it correctly.

Unclogging a Myers Water Pump: A Step-by-Step Guide
Dealing with a clogged Myers water pump can be frustrating, but it's usually a fix you can tackle yourself. Before diving in, double check you've shut down the power to the pump for your safety. Let's commence by checking the impeller. This part often gets clogged with debris, causing a reduction in water flow. You can often locate it inside the pump housing. Use a pliers to dislodge any material you see. If that doesn't solve it, inspect the suction line. Look for any kinks in the line, as these can hinder the pump's function. Using a pressurized water source through the suction line can sometimes clear out any stubborn clogs.
